public class JerseyClientBuilder extends ClientBuilder {
private final ClientConfig config;
private HostnameVerifier hostnameVerifier;
private final SslContextClientBuilder sslContextClientBuilder = new SslContextClientBuilder();
private static final List<ClientBuilderListener> CLIENT_BUILDER_LISTENERS;
static {
final List<RankedProvider<ClientBuilderListener>> listeners = new LinkedList<>();
for (ClientBuilderListener listener : ServiceFinder.find(ClientBuilderListener.class)) {
listeners.add(new RankedProvider<>(listener));
}
listeners.sort(new RankedComparator<>(RankedComparator.Order.ASCENDING));
final List<ClientBuilderListener> sortedList = new LinkedList<>();
for (RankedProvider<ClientBuilderListener> listener : listeners) {
sortedList.add(listener.getProvider());
}
CLIENT_BUILDER_LISTENERS = Collections.unmodifiableList(sortedList);
}
/**
* Create a new custom-configured {@link JerseyClient} instance.
*
* @return new configured Jersey client instance.
* @since 2.5
*/
public static JerseyClient createClient() {
return new JerseyClientBuilder().build();
}
/**
* Create a new custom-configured {@link JerseyClient} instance.
*
* @param configuration data used to provide initial configuration for the new
* Jersey client instance.
* @return new configured Jersey client instance.
* @since 2.5
*/
public static JerseyClient createClient(Configuration configuration) {
return new JerseyClientBuilder().withConfig(configuration).build();
}
/**
* Create new Jersey client builder instance.
*/
public JerseyClientBuilder() {
this.config = new ClientConfig();
init(this);
}
private static void init(ClientBuilder builder) {
for (ClientBuilderListener listener : CLIENT_BUILDER_LISTENERS) {
listener.onNewBuilder(builder);
}
}
@Override
public JerseyClientBuilder sslContext(SSLContext sslContext) {
sslContextClientBuilder.sslContext(sslContext);
return this;
}
@Override
public JerseyClientBuilder keyStore(KeyStore keyStore, char[] password) {
sslContextClientBuilder.keyStore(keyStore, password);
return this;
}
@Override
public JerseyClientBuilder trustStore(KeyStore trustStore) {
sslContextClientBuilder.trustStore(trustStore);
return this;
}
@Override
public JerseyClientBuilder hostnameVerifier(HostnameVerifier hostnameVerifier) {
this.hostnameVerifier = hostnameVerifier;
return this;
}
@Override
public ClientBuilder executorService(ExecutorService executorService) {
config.executorService(executorService);
return this;
}
@Override
public ClientBuilder scheduledExecutorService(ScheduledExecutorService scheduledExecutorService) {
config.scheduledExecutorService(scheduledExecutorService);
return this;
}
@Override
public ClientBuilder connectTimeout(long timeout, TimeUnit unit) {
if (timeout < 0) {
throw new IllegalArgumentException("Negative timeout.");
}
this.property(ClientProperties.CONNECT_TIMEOUT, Math.toIntExact(unit.toMillis(timeout)));
return this;
}
@Override
public ClientBuilder readTimeout(long timeout, TimeUnit unit) {
if (timeout < 0) {
throw new IllegalArgumentException("Negative timeout.");
}
this.property(ClientProperties.READ_TIMEOUT, Math.toIntExact(unit.toMillis(timeout)));
return this;
}
@Override
public JerseyClient build() {
ExternalPropertiesConfigurationFactory.configure(this.config);
setConnectorFromProperties();
return new JerseyClient(config, sslContextClientBuilder, hostnameVerifier, null);
}
